Health care policy decisions based on sound data and research are essential for addressing the challenges.

Pharmacistsa are a viral part of the health care ecosystem, relied on by patients to help them navigate an evermore-complex health care system.

Their first-hand knowledge about the challenges patients face at the pharmacy counter is vital to the conversation about how the ecosystem is or is not serving patients.

When I was in pharmacy school, I thought the relationship between drug company, patient, payer, and pharmacy was straightforward: Drug companies make drugs and ship them to pharmacies; patients buy health insurance from payers, who pay pharmacies for the drugs; patients obtain their drugs from the pharmacy and go home happy (Figure 1).
